Four Northern European ports have been granted EU funding for projects to reduce emissions from containerships moored at their quays.

OPS for container ships is a crucial part for all the ports involved,” Anne Zachariassen, COO of Port of Aarhus and project coordinator, commented. As explained, the project is a direct response to new EU regulations that will come into effect in 2030, requiring ships over 5,000 gross tonnage to connect to onshore power supply while moored.
Of the 31 ports studied, only 4 have installed or contracted more than half of the connections required by 2030. Because they spend significantly more time at berth, cruise ships produce more than six times more port-side emissions than container ships.
